Basic Steps for RTO Registration

Early Research and Planning: Prior to begin the RTO enrolment steps, conduct exhaustive investigation to understand the interest for the offerings you will offer. Make sure you satisfy the basic requirements, like having suitable premises and qualified staff.

Application Document Compilation: Prepare detailed documentation illustrating your adherence with the VET Quality Framework and the National Standards for RTOs 2024. Major records for example your business plan, evaluation strategies (TAS), and policies and procedures.

Sending Application: Submit your application using ASQA's internet portal, with all required documentation and the registration fee.

Inspection by ASQA: ASQA will evaluate your sign-up and may conduct a site audit to verify meeting the regulations. In the process of this inspection, ASQA will evaluate your facilities, materials, and documents.

Conclusion and Registration: If your application satisfies all guidelines, ASQA will register your company as an RTO, delivering you with a Certification of Registration and adding your facts on the national listing.

Necessary Conditions for RTO Registration

Fiscal Viability: You need to demonstrate that your institution is financially viable, presenting financial projections, funding evidence, and a comprehensive business plan.

Fit and Proper Person Requirements: ASQA requires that important personnel in your entity comply with the fit and proper person criteria, such as having a good character and no record of serious crimes.

Training and Assessment Resources: Ascertain you have necessary resources to deliver and assess the subjects you offer, for instance competent trainers and evaluators, suitable premises, and suitable educational materials.

Compliance with VET Quality Framework and National Standards for RTOs 2024: Your entity must fulfil the VET Quality Framework, including the Standards for RTOs 2015, the Fit and Proper Person Standards, the Financial Viability Risk Assessment Guidelines, the Data Provision Standards, and the Australian Qualifications Framework. Financial Requirements for RTO Registration

The expenses associated with RTO registration can differ contingent on several variables, like the dimension of your company, the courses you want to offer, and the materials you must have. Here are some common charges you may face:

- Application Charge: ASQA demands an enrolment fee for RTO registration, which can vary depending on the scope and dimension of your registration.
- Review Costs: If ASQA performs a facility audit, you may need to pay the fees connected to the inspection, like travel charges for ASQA auditors.
- Assets Costs: Spending on assessment resources, for example certified trainers and assessors, adequate premises, and proper educational materials.
- Professional Fees: Employing a expert for support with the enrolment process will incur additional fees.
